出 处:《塑性工程学报》1999年第2期50-52,共3页Journal of Plasticity Engineering
摘 要:本文提出非均匀压边力板料粘性介质拉深成形方法,这种方法采用一种介于液—固态之间的粘性介质作为凸模传力介质,通过控制板料局部压边力的不同,使板料可控制地流入凹模口,板料成形具有顺序性。给出了拉深件几何形状和厚度分布,试验结果表明:板料厚度的变化受板料流入凹模深度的影响。Viscous pressure drawing of sheet metal under the condition of nonuniform blank holder force is proposed in this paperThe viscous and flowable semisolid medium is used as pressurecarring medium of sheet metal formingThe sheet material is controllablly pressured into the die cavity in coordination with the locally adjustable blank holder forceSheet is formed in a definite sequenceThe shape and thickness distribution of drawing specimens were obtained.The experimental results show that the thicness variation is affected by the depth of moving particle in the sheet into the die cavityBy sequential forming method,the thinning occurred from the increasing depth of specimens can be decreased
